Frequently Asked Questions
How do I find the right alternators for my Audi A6?
Verify compatibility using your Audi A6's VIN number, production year (2019-2024), and engine code. Check seller compatibility charts and cross-reference OEM part numbers when possible.
How often should I replace alternators on my Audi A6?
General guideline: 100,000-150,000 miles, varies by vehicle and conditions. However, driving conditions (city vs highway, climate, towing) affect replacement frequency. Inspect regularly and replace when warning signs appear.
Should I use OEM or aftermarket alternators for my Audi A6?
OEM parts guarantee exact Audi specifications and fitment. Quality aftermarket brands often meet or exceed OEM standards at lower prices. For warranty vehicles, check if aftermarket parts affect coverage.
What are signs that my Audi A6 needs new alternators?
Common warning signs include: Dim or flickering lights, Battery warning light, Dead battery, Whining noise, Electrical issues. If you notice any of these symptoms, inspect or replace the alternators promptly to prevent further damage.
Can I install alternators on my Audi A6 myself?
Possible for DIYers with intermediate skills. Expect 1-3 hours. Always consult your owner's manual and follow proper safety procedures.
